Getting rid of the monoculture isn’t just about hiring or promoting people. It’s about figuring out how to organizationally shift the locus of power and control away from those who’ve had it, without question, for so long. This is, in a sense, a radical change when it comes to power dynamics inside companies, and the process will likely create some sort of tension. But it’s wrong to think of these changes one-dimensionally — as a power grab, or an overthrow of an old regime. That kind of thinking is zero-sum, destined to fail, and not how inclusion actually works.
